The Speed Camera Lottery
Volkswagen conducted an experiment that saw the average speed drop from 32kmph before the experiment to 25 kmph during the experiment.

Plastic as marine litter
Plastics are the largest component of human-generated solid waste entering the seas and oceans. This essay discusses the dump of plastic, its consequences, and the lack of action taken.
